SEDA Strengthens Its Mining & Metals Expertise with the Addition of Alastair McIntyre

Yahoo Finance· July 11, 2026

SEDA Experts LLC has appointed Alastair McIntyre as Managing Director to enhance its specialized financial expert witness services within the mining and metals industry. McIntyre brings decades of experience in metals banking, trading, and mine development to the firm, having served in senior roles across North America, Australia, and Asia. This appointment strengthens SEDA’s ability to provide technical and financial advisory services for complex sector-specific litigation, M&A, and capital raising.

SEDA Experts LLC, a leading financial expert witness firm, has announced that Alastair McIntyre has joined as Managing Director to bolster its mining and metals expertise. McIntyre is a specialist in precious and base metals markets with extensive experience in metals banking, trading, and mine development. His expertise covers a wide range of financial and operational areas, including physical and derivative transactions, royalty agreements, off-take and metal loan arrangements, and technical due diligence. Managing Partner Peter Selman noted that McIntyre’s addition is a strategic move to provide critical industry-specific insights to the firm's clients.

McIntyre currently holds leadership positions as the President, CEO, and Board Member of Altiplano Metals, overseeing copper-gold production and processing operations in Chile, and as President of Malagash Metals and Mining Limited. His career includes significant advisory roles, such as serving as the commercial advisor for the Hong Kong Stock Exchange’s US$2.1 billion acquisition of the London Metal Exchange. He also previously served as Senior Managing Director for Asia at Behre Dolbear, where he led technical and financial reviews for IPO listings on the Hong Kong and Singapore stock exchanges.

Before his advisory roles, McIntyre spent more than ten years at Scotiabank/ScotiaMocatta in senior positions focused on metals marketing, derivatives, and structured products. His professional background also includes experience with the Commonwealth Bank of Australia, Natixis, and the Royal Canadian Mint. A Professional Geologist (P.Geo) and Chartered Professional with AusIMM, McIntyre holds degrees in Geology and Business Administration from Dalhousie University. His deep technical and financial background enables him to provide expert testimony in complex litigation involving precious metals and tax matters.
